Produktbeschreibung
Electrical energy consumption at global level is rising day by day and therefore, there is a steady increase in the demand for power generation. In addition, increasing concern for environment has led to the growing interest in innovative technologies for generation of clean and renewable electrical energy. To meet the above two aspects, large quantity of renewable energy generation is being integrated into the power system in addition to the conventional power generation. Wind energy is one among the most available and exploitable forms of renewable energy. It is also the most reliable and developed form of renewable energy source. Also, a wind electric generation system is the most cost competitive of all the environmentally clean and safe renewable energy sources in the world. Ultimately, wind energy has emerged as the most viable source of electrical power and is economically competitive with conventional sources.
Autorenporträt
Dr.Rakesh Chandra was born in 1987 and did his B.Tech from JNTUH in 2008 and he received both his M.Tech and Ph.D degrees from NIT Warangal in 2010 and 2016 respectively. He won prestigious international Erasmus scholarship in 2013 and POSOCO award for the best Ph.D thesis in 2017. His areas of interest are wind power grid integration issues.
